Here's some pictures to show the Sherman Launch change I am proposing. The 1st satellite photo shows the current situation. This photo was at low tide. At high tide there's no sandy beach, and it takes longer to get out from shore. A is the beginner waterstart site and B is the beginner kite launch site.
The 2nd photo shows my proposed launch with a clockwise rotation from the kite launch area (out of the photo below and to the right).
